%X According to the actual traffic movement under a two-phase signal, the most obvious and definite position reflecting the green period used by the vehicles passing through the intersection is the through-left conflict point and not the stop-line. This note presents a new method of traffic signal timing of isolated, fixed time, two-phase signals by considering the conflict point as the investigative section.   <p>Language: en</p>
